Closure Process
- ChurchCare’s counselor will offer counsel concerning final business meetings, missionary support, severance package, parsonage use, sale or donation of furnishings and equipment.
- ChurchCare has counselors experienced in leading a church through the difficult and emotional decisions associated with dissolving a church.
- Once the church votes to use ChurchCare, a process begins to transition all business related issues to ChurchCare. All assets and liabilities will be managed by our staff. ChurchCare will receive all mail and handle the payment of all invoices. The emotional break from the church, for the existing leadership, will be handled with care and understanding.
- Legal counsel will be used to determine the requirements for transfer of assets, and all issues will be completed in a manner that maintains the testimony of our Lord in the community.
- ChurchCare will maintain custody of Church records and documents for the required period of time.
- Members will be encouraged to seek out another church to join and become involved in ministry. Members may need a time of healing and encouragement. Becoming involved in a sister church with compassionate leadership, will provide opportunity for healing.
- A sample dissolution resolution is included in this application. Please consult with ChurchCare before voting on a dissolution resolution, each state has different requirements.
